Output 43b41ba7188029717830ff642f0d5bbc2704e1740ac123be051f2c33345849a7:1

value
75683788
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1ccf583cd4cf120c2b16cb3c5347546b87defab OP_EQUAL
address
3PjYJaXN562vPjQUE79V4RBRrFrFy73txk
transaction
43b41ba7188029717830ff642f0d5bbc2704e1740ac123be051f2c33345849a7
spent
true